Open : Mon-Fri from 10-4 At Koi-B, we offer a wide variety of enrichment classes, art, and homeschool classes. But, what truly defines our space is community. As a mother of four and a homeschooling parent, I know firsthand how busy life can g

et, so I design my classes and workshops with that in mind. Whether you're juggling the chaos of motherhood or need a creative outlet, our flexible offerings are here to fit your schedule. We host classes each week to provide extracurricular opportunities for homeschoolers and children looking to express themselves through art. All of our classes are inclusive, meaning that we welcome all of our friends to all of our classes, no matter the ability. We have educators and behavioral specialists on staff to accomodate most special needs. I’d love to welcome you to our space! Whether you're here to create, connect, or simply find some peace, there’s a place for you at Koi.b Collective. We can’t wait to meet you and share in the journey of healing and creativity together! For the last several months, I've been praying about how to create a space where women can truly connect, encourage one another, and grow together in Christ.

As a military spouse, mother, educator, counselor, and former farm owner, I've walked through many different seasons of life. (It is almost comical.) I've experienced deployments, homeschooling, raising children, building a business, caring for a home, and trying to balance all the things God has entrusted to me.

One thing I've learned is that women really need community. I really need community.

We need a place to talk about faith, family, wellness, motherhood, homeschooling, military life, healthy living, and the everyday joys and challenges of caring for those we love.

For years, I made many of our family's products from scratch on our farm in Florida. Creating healthier options for my children became a passion of mine, and recently I've felt God nudging me back toward those roots, not just for my own family, but as a way to gather and encourage other women.

I have decided to start with a once-per-month fellowship, we shall call it, "The Well."

The Well is a Christ-centered fellowship where women can gather to be refreshed, encouraged, and equipped. We'll share coffee, conversation, Bible journaling, prayer, practical skills, wellness topics, and real-life encouragement for every season of life.

Our first gathering will be a special Founding Fellowship Event where we'll make homemade sunscreen and sunscreen chapstick while discussing faith, stewardship, wellness, family rhythms, and Christ-centered living.

If we're being honest, asking for help doesn't come naturally to us.

As a nonprofit, we've always done our best to stretch every dollar, roll up our sleeves, and create meaningful opportunities for the children and families we serve. But as Koi-B continues to grow, we're finding ourselves in a season where we simply can't do it all alone.

This summer, we're preparing to launch new programs in art, music, movement, and community enrichment. As our center grows, we're also realizing the need for more open floor space and more efficient workspaces that better serve our students.

Thanks to the incredible generosity of Lowe's Community Partners, our flooring will be replaced during the first week of July. If you've seen photos of our janky floors, well... that's what years of creativity, hard work, and lots of little feet look like. 😝

Now we're hoping to take one more step forward.

Our goal is to replace our current tables with 5 round tables featuring built-in storage and seating for 25 children. These tables will create welcoming spaces for conversation, collaboration, creativity, and connection while giving us the flexibility we need for new dance, movement, and music programs.

The truth is, expenses are mounting as we prepare for this next season of growth. At the same time, we're committed to continuing our scholarship opportunities for families who need them. We never want improvements to our space or new programs to come at the expense of the children who rely on those opportunities.
